RESEARCH ACTIVITY

The research activity of Federica Zanotto is mainly addressed to the study of corrosion and corrosion protection of metal alloys. The main research topics from 2010 up to 2018 were:

-     Corrosion resistance (pitting corrosion, stress corrosion cracking and intergranular corrosion) of several innovative biphasic stainless steels (LDX 2101®, LDX 2404®, UNS S32304 e UNS S32760) in critical conditions and/or aggressive environments (after thermal aging, media rich in chlorides and sulphides ions).

-     Corrosion resistance of reinforcing bars in alkali-activated fly ash mortars.

-     Corrosion and corrosion protection of bronze and glided bronze in the field of cultural heritage.

-     Corrosion protection of magnesium alloys with eco-friendly silane-based coatings, mono-carboxylate conversion coatings and corrosion inhibition by anionic surfactants.
